Pre-proposal - Dash for the Belt

Dash for the Belt

d0PRGf6.jpg

TL;DR

GreenCandle is proud to present a unique and exciting opportunity to gain massive exposure to a crypto-friendly target demographic during a special primetime event on a major TV network. On January 18, SpikeTV is re-branding to Paramount Network (owned by Paramount Pictures) - a move that will take the programming more mainstream, and branch out from its current base of 98M North American subscribers, consisting primarily of males aged 18-49. Coincidentally, this audience is the same demographic of the typical crypto early adopter and this opportunity could reap a huge return on investment with massive positive exposure for Dash.

On January 20th, the Inaugural Celebration of this re-branding will be a major Mixed Martial Arts main event TV broadcast. As a result of coingun’s outreach to Firas Zahabi at Tristar Gym in a previous proposal, GreenCandle has been able to secure an opportunity to sponsor Rory MacDonald for the main event welterweight title fight during this special TV event. Rory MacDonald is one of the few MMA stars that promotes cryptocurrency on a daily basis to his 217K twitter followers and MMA fans. Rory has been quoted as saying that he wants his entire $500K purse to be paid in crypto! Rory tweets consistently about bitcoin and bitcoin cash and we now have the opportunity to teach him, MMA fans and his twitter followers about the benefits of Dash. As a bonus, Rory is one of the most desirable and brand-friendly MMA stars and is challenging the current champion, Douglas Lima in a highly-anticipated match. Rory is in the best shape of his career, coming off a spectacular, dominating TKO win over top contender Paul Daley in August 2017.

As part of the sponsorship, GreenCandle will be sending a swag package to Rory for his pre-fight interviews and gym workouts to have Dash on full display for the build-up of the event. Rory will be tweeting about Dash and possibly mention it during interviews. During the walk-out, Dash-branded attire will be seen front and center on the t-shirt and shorts. During the fight, Dash will be visible on the left leg of the shorts and after the fight with a “trucker” hat. Also a representative from GC will be at the event to insure Dash has maximum exposure.

The Audience

The target demographic of this type of event is ideal for Dash and consistent with our user-base. SpikeTV has 98.7M paid subscribers in North America. Bellator attracts a male demographic aged 18-49, which is the same demographic of the typical crypto enthusiast and early adopter. Typically, the viewership for Bellator fight nights is around 1M, however, this event will be hyped due to the re-branding and as a result we expect more than 1M viewers for this event. With this sponsorship, Dash could be the first alternative cryptocurrency that many of these viewers are made aware of.

I hope this passes and if it does I would double check the contract to see if you are right about this...
"We will be seeing the dash logo on fight pass for years to come."
The reason I ask is because the UFC and most shows blur out the logos on replays. Sometimes it is to not associate the brand with the show but I think it is usually because they want said brand to pay again for the advertising after the initial first airing. Get it in writing!
